怎么吧php源码转换为asp

fiy 其他 99

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要将PHP源码转换为ASP,可以按照以下步骤进行:

    1. 理解PHP和ASP的差异:PHP是一种开源的服务器端脚本语言,而ASP是一种由微软开发的服务器端脚本语言。它们有着不同的语法和特性,所以在转换代码之前,需要了解它们的差异。

    2. 找出PHP源码中的关键代码:浏览PHP源码,找出其中的核心功能和重要代码。这些代码是需要转换的重点。

    3. 学习ASP语法和特性:ASP使用VBScript作为其默认的脚本语言,所以在转换代码之前,要学习ASP的语法和特性。这包括变量声明、条件语句、循环语句等。

    4. 逐行将PHP代码转换为ASP代码:根据在前面步骤中学到的ASP语法,逐行将PHP代码转换为ASP代码。这可能涉及到修改变量名、函数名以及一些语法结构等。

    5. 调试和测试转换后的ASP代码:在转换完成之后,进行调试和测试,确保转换后的ASP代码能够正常运行并产生预期的结果。

    需要注意的是,由于PHP和ASP有一些语法和特性上的差异,所以并不是所有的PHP代码都可以直接转换为ASP代码。在转换过程中,可能会遇到一些特定的问题和挑战,需要根据具体情况进行解决。同时,还需要根据实际需求,调整转换后的ASP代码,以确保它能够适应ASP的环境和要求。

    总之,将PHP源码转换为ASP需要理解两种语言的差异,学习ASP的语法和特性,逐行转换代码,并进行测试和调试。正确的转换方法和技巧可以帮助您顺利完成这一任务。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    将 PHP 源码转换为 ASP 是一项相当复杂的任务,因为这两种编程语言之间有许多差异和限制。下面是一些将 PHP 源码转换为 ASP 的基本步骤和注意事项:

    1. 语法转换:首先,需要将 PHP 源码中的语法和函数转换为相应的 ASP 语法和函数。PHP 使用类 C 语言风格的语法,而 ASP 使用基于 VBScript 的语法。因此,将 PHP 中的控制结构(如 if、for和while 语句)转换为 ASP 的对应语法是非常重要的。

    2. 变量和数据类型:PHP 和 ASP 支持不同的数据类型和变量规则。确保将 PHP 中的变量和数据类型转换为 ASP 中支持的相应类型和规则。例如,将 PHP 的字符串型变量转换为 ASP 的字符串型变量,并注意 PHP 和 ASP 的变量作用域的差异。

    3. 文件引用和包含:PHP 和 ASP 使用不同的方式来引用和包含其他文件。在将 PHP 源码转换为 ASP 时,需要将原始的 PHP 文件引用和包含语句转换为 ASP 的语法,并确保引用的文件也是 ASP 格式的。

    4. 数据库访问和查询:PHP 和 ASP 有不同的数据库访问和查询语法。如果你的 PHP 源码中包含与数据库相关的代码,需要将其转换为 ASP 中的相应语法和函数。这可能涉及到修改 SQL 查询语句的语法、更改数据库连接代码等方面。

    5. 逻辑和功能转换:PHP 和 ASP 虽然都是用于开发 Web 应用程序的脚本语言,但它们在一些逻辑和功能方面有所不同。在将 PHP 源码转换为 ASP 时,需要考虑这些差异,并相应地调整代码逻辑和功能。例如,PHP 中常用的表单处理、会话管理和文件上传功能需要使用 ASP 的对应功能实现。

    总结:
    将 PHP 源码转换为 ASP 是一个复杂的任务,要注意语法、变量和数据类型、文件引用和包含、数据库访问和查询以及逻辑和功能等方面的差异。在转换过程中,需要仔细分析和修改 PHP 源码,确保转换后的 ASP 代码能够正确运行并实现相同的功能。考虑到 PHP 和 ASP 的差异,有时可能需要重新设计和实现某些功能。因此,在进行转换之前,建议先评估是否有必要将 PHP 源码转换为 ASP,以及转换后的代码是否能够满足你的需求和预期。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    将PHP源码转换为ASP可以通过以下步骤完成:

    1. 理解PHP和ASP的基本语法和特性:首先,要了解PHP和ASP的基本语法和特性,包括变量声明、数据类型、控制流语句、循环结构、函数定义等。这样能够更好地理解和转换PHP源码。

    2. 分析和理解PHP源码:仔细阅读并分析要转换的PHP源码。理解代码的功能和逻辑结构,包括输入输出、数据处理、数据库查询、用户认证等部分。

    3. 逐行转换代码:按照ASP的语法和规范,逐行转换PHP代码。需要注意的是,PHP和ASP在一些语法和函数方面存在差异,因此需要仔细修改代码以确保其在ASP环境中正常工作。

    4. 调试和测试:完成代码转换后,进行调试和测试。确保代码在ASP环境中能够正常运行并达到预期的功能。

    5. 数据库迁移:如果PHP源码涉及数据库操作,需要将数据库迁移到ASP对应的数据库系统中,并修改相关的连接和查询语句。

    6. 优化和完善:在转换过程中,可以考虑对代码进行优化和完善,如简化逻辑、提高性能等方面的改进。

    7. 测试和验收:最后,进行全面的测试和验收,确保转换后的ASP源码在实际环境中能够正常运行并达到预期效果。

    总结:
    将PHP源码转换为ASP需要对PHP和ASP的语法和特性有一定的了解,并仔细分析和转换源码。调试、测试和优化是不可或缺的步骤,确保转换后的ASP源码在实际环境中能够正常运行。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部